Change Equation

Change Equation · Change framework

Everyone agrees change is needed, yet the organization still does not move.

Why use it

Test whether dissatisfaction, vision, and first steps are strong enough to overcome resistance.

How to apply

  1. Define the specific management situation and desired outcome.
  2. Gather the minimum facts, constraints, and perspectives needed to use the tool.
  3. Apply Change Equation, make key assumptions explicit, and compare the result with realistic alternatives.
  4. Record the decision, next owner or action, and a testable criterion for the next step.

Output

A diagnosis of the missing component in the change equation.
